A TALE OF TWO GLOBALIZATIONS : GAINS FOR TRADE AND OPENNESS 1800-2010 [DATA SET]

  • Federico, Giovanni
  • Tena Junguito, Antonio
This dataset in an Excel file compares the wave of globalization before the outbreak of the Great Recession in 2007 with its alleged historical antecedent before the outbreak of World War One. We describe trends in trade and openness, estimate the gains from trade and investigate the proximate causes of the growth of openness. We argue that the conventional wisdom has to be revised. The first wave of globalization started around 1820 and culminated around 1870. In the next century, trade continued to grow, with the exception of the Great Depression, but openness and gains fluctuated widely. Growth resumed in the early 1970s. By 2007, the world was more open than a century earlier and its inhabitants gained from trade substantially more than their ancestors did. The current wave of globalization, in spite of some similarities with previous trends, has no historical antecedents. This dataset is related to the working paper"A tale of two globalizations : gains for trade and openness 1800-2010"by Giovanni Federico and Antonio Tena Junguito, available on (2016-02)

SUPPLEMENTARY MATERIAL FOR THE ARTICLE "A COMPARISON OF THE USEFULNESS OF GAME-BASED LEARNING AND VIDEO-BASED LEARNING FOR TEACHING SOFTWARE ENGINEERING IN ONLINE ENVIRONMENTS"

  • Gordillo Méndez, Aldo
  • López Fernández, Daniel
  • Tovar Caro, Edmundo
  • Mayor Márquez, Jesús
This dataset contains the data related to the article "A Comparison of the Usefulness of Game-Based Learning and Video-Based Learning for Teaching Software Engineering in Online Environments" with DOI 10.1109/FIE58773.2023.10343449. This dataset contains data of 193 software engineering students: 45 in the control group and 148 in the experimental group. Both groups took a lesson about software design, but the students in the control group learned through online video-based learning, whereas their counterparts in the experimental group learned through online game-based learning. The dataset is provided through an XLSX file with two sheets: 1) GBLGroup. This sheet contains the data related to the experimental group. 2) VBLGroup. This sheet contains the data related to the control group. The dataset contains the following data for each student: * Pre-test and post-test scores. * Learning gains, calculated as the difference between the post-test and the pre-test score. * Age and gender. * Results of a perceptions questionnaire with 9 items. * Comments (in Spanish). All data is anonymized so that the identity of the participants cannot be ascertained. SERVANDO RODRÍGUEZ. (SAN JORGE DE ALOR). VINO Y ACEITE

  • Álvarez Pérez, Xosé Afonso (coord.)
Actualmente no se hace vino en Olivenza. Los mayores dicen que sí se hacía hace tiempo, en la sierra, pero se cambiaron las viñas por olivos. Actualmente hay muchos menos lagares, solo hay dos operativos. Léxico del olivo y de la aceituna. Canciones e historias ligadas a los trabajos del campo. Las mujeres hacían muchas bromas de carácter sexual a los hombres que estaban con ellas trabajando en el campo. Una de las más características era el “jogo da barrela”: coger a un hombre entre varias mujeres y meterle hierba por debajo de la ropa., Actualmente, não se faz vinho em Olivença. STATISTICAL CORRELATION ANALYSIS ON INDOOR AIR HIGH-PRIORITY POLLUTANTS IN SPANISH PUBLIC PRIMARY SCHOOLS [DATASET]

  • Calama González, Carmen Maria
  • Redondas Marrero, María Dolores
  • Sabariego Moreno, Kevin
  • Barbero Barrera, María del Mar
The project conducted presents a comprehensive assessment of indoor air quality in public primary schools across Madrid (Spain). Several classrooms have been monitored for a year, registering indoor air concentrations and outdoor ambient levels. Later, a statistical analysis has been performed to explore correlations between indoor air pollutant concentrations during occupied and unoccupied periods, as well as the impact of student activities and classroom operation, among other factors. The dataset provides monitoring information of indoor and outdoor variables included in one file named as "Dataset_SchoolMonitoring.csv". Specifically, four Public Primary Schools were monitored in Madrid (Spain), registering indoor air quality data (from 2 to 3 classrooms per school) and outdoor air quality information from both punctual measurements and a local weather station close to the schools.Punctual monitoring measures were conducted during February, April, May, October and December in 2023. Specifically, indoor variables monitored in the classrooms are refered to: - TVOC (ppb) - Ultrafine PM (from 0.02 to 1 μm) (part./cm3) - PM0.3 (part./cm3and μg/m3) - PM1 (part./cm3 and μg/m3) - PM2.5 (part./cm3 and μg/m3) - CO2 (ppm) - Temperature (ºC) - Relative Humidity (%) - Formaldehyde (µg/m3) Also, punctual outdoor measurements of the aforementioned parameters have been also included in the dataset. Additionally, outdoor variables recorded in a local weather station have also been incorporated into the dataset: - Wind speed (m/s) - Wind direction (º) - Outdoor temperature (ºC) - Outdoor Relative humidity (%) - Atmospheric pressure (mb) - Solar Radiation (W/m2) - Rain (l/m2) - NO (µg/m3) - NO2 (µg/m3) - PM10 (µg/m3) - Nox (µg/m3) - O3 (µg/m3) Furthermore, indoor students interaction and classroom operation aspects are incorporated into the study through several variables, which are assigned two possible values: 1 means "Open, ON, Considered"; while 0 means "Closed, OFF, None": - Door opening (1/0) - Window opening (1/0) - Artificial lights operation (1/0) - Students’ interaction (Activity) (1/0) - VOC emissions (Materials) (1/0) - PM emissions (1/0) - Technological devices (1/0) A more detail description of each variable may be found in the paper referenced in the Related publication section., Punctual measurements were taken with several monitoring equipment (DRÄGER X-pid 9500, Particle counter PCE-PQC 12EU, P-Track Ultrafine 8525 TSI and DIOXCARE DX75 sensors) of the variables described in 4. Description of the dataset. After downloading the data from the sensors, the monitored information was processed and compiled to create a .csv file using the open access .R software v. 4.3.3.
